亚洲激情专区-91九色丨porny丨老师-久久久久久久女国产乱让韩-国产精品午夜小视频观看

溫馨提示×

如何優化inceptor sql性能

sql
小樊
82
2024-10-19 22:20:37
欄目: 云計算

優化Inceptor SQL性能可以從多個方面入手,以下是一些建議:

  1. 使用預編譯語句:預編譯語句可以提高SQL查詢的效率,因為它們只需要被編譯一次,然后可以被多次執行。這可以減少SQL解析和編譯的時間,提高查詢性能。
  2. 優化SQL查詢:避免使用復雜的SQL查詢,尤其是那些包含多個子查詢或連接的查詢。盡量將復雜查詢拆分成多個簡單查詢,或者使用視圖、存儲過程等來簡化查詢邏輯。
  3. 使用索引:索引可以顯著提高SQL查詢的性能。為經常用于查詢條件的列創建索引,可以加快查詢速度。但是,要注意不要過度索引,因為索引會占用額外的存儲空間,并且會影響插入、更新和刪除操作的性能。
  4. 調整Inceptor配置:Inceptor提供了一些配置選項,可以用來優化SQL性能。例如,可以調整緩存大小、連接池大小、線程池大小等參數,以適應不同的應用場景和負載情況。
  5. 使用批處理:對于大量的插入、更新或刪除操作,可以使用批處理來提高性能。批處理可以將多個操作合并成一個網絡請求,減少網絡開銷和數據庫壓力。
  6. **避免使用select ***:在查詢數據時,盡量避免使用select *語句,而是只選擇需要的列。這可以減少數據傳輸量和內存占用,提高查詢性能。
  7. 使用連接池:連接池可以管理數據庫連接,避免頻繁地創建和關閉連接。這可以減少連接建立和釋放的開銷,提高數據庫訪問性能。
  8. 避免SQL注入:確保應用程序中的SQL查詢是安全的,避免SQL注入攻擊。使用參數化查詢或預編譯語句來防止SQL注入,并提高查詢性能。
  9. 監控和分析SQL性能:使用數據庫監控工具來分析SQL查詢的性能,找出性能瓶頸并進行優化。監控工具可以提供關于查詢執行時間、資源消耗等詳細信息,幫助開發者識別問題并進行改進。

總之,優化Inceptor SQL性能需要綜合考慮多個方面,包括預編譯語句、SQL查詢優化、索引使用、Inceptor配置調整、批處理、避免select *、連接池使用、避免SQL注入以及監控和分析SQL性能等。通過這些措施,可以提高SQL查詢的效率,提升應用程序的性能和用戶體驗。

0
壶关县| 威信县| 元江| 清流县| 泗水县| 句容市| 台湾省| 修武县| 江西省| 海晏县| 嵊州市| 南川市| 靖边县| 彰化市| 张家港市| 古丈县| 景泰县| 嵊泗县| 阿合奇县| 山西省| 吕梁市| 昌乐县| 明星| 南涧| 同心县| 廉江市| 江永县| 商城县| 灯塔市| 潮安县| 嵊州市| 卢龙县| 新宁县| 富阳市| 泽普县| 全南县| 娱乐| 宣恩县| 田林县| 石景山区| 泰和县|